Problem
Conventional nutritional plant treatments are ineffective in addressing environmental stresses such as drought, salinity, low light, water logging, disease, and pests, and fail to enhance plant biology under these conditions.
Innovation Solution
A method involving an aqueous mixture of complex polymeric polyhydroxy acids (CPPA) with added transition metal cations or alkali/earth metal salts, applied to plants or their loci, to synergistically enhance biological processes, including nutrient availability and stress tolerance.

A method of effecting at least one biological process in a plant is disclosed. The method comprises contacting a part of a seed, a plant, or the locus thereof with a mixture comprising an agriculturally acceptable mixture of (i) complex polymeric polyhydroxy acids and (ii) a phytotoxic amount of one or more alkali (earth) salts and/or a synergistic amount of at least one source of an agriculturally acceptable transition metal ions.
